| カラム名 | カラム型 | カラム制約 | テーブル制約 |
|---|---|---|---|
| service_id | UNSIGNED INT | NOT NULL | プライマリ・キー。 |
| service_name | CHAR(128) | NOT NULL | |
| service_type | VARCHAR (40) | NOT NULL | |
| auth_required | CHAR(1) | NOT NULL | |
| secure_required | CHAR(1) | NOT NULL | |
| url_path | CHAR(1) | NOT NULL | |
| user_id | UNSIGNED INT | ||
| parameter | VARCHAR (250) | ||
| statement | LONG VARCHAR | ||
| remarks | LONG VARCHAR |
各ローは Web サービスの記述を保持します。
service_id Web サービスをユニークに識別する番号。
service_name Web サービスに割り当てられた名前。
service_type サービスのタイプには、RAW、HTTP、XML、SOAP、DISH などがあります。
auth_required (Y/N) すべての要求に、有効なユーザ名とパスワードが必要かどうかを示します。
secure_required (Y/N) HTTP などのセキュリティ保護されていない接続を受け入れるのか、または HTTPS などのセキュリティ保護された接続だけを受け入れるのかを示します。
url_path URL の解釈を制御します。
user_id 認証が有効の場合、サービス使用のパーミッションを持つユーザまたはユーザ・グループを識別します。認証が無効の場合、要求を処理するときに使用するアカウントを指定します。
parameter DISH サービスにインクルードされる SOAP サービスを識別するプレフィクス。
statement 要求に応答して常に実行される SQL 文。NULL の場合、各要求に含まれる任意の文が代わりに実行されます。DISH 型のサービスでは無視されます。
SQL Anywhere Studio 9.0.2
Copyright © 1989–2005 Sybase, Inc. Portions copyright © 2001–2005 iAnywhere Solutions, Inc. All rights reserved.